You realize we have said this for every OC hire Miles has made, right? Its always the opposite of what everyone thinks.
The only hire that was exactly what everyone had hoped was the Ed O hire. Everything else has been the worst or close to worst possible hire of the possible candidates. Les will not and cannot hire a new and upcoming OC. Why you ask?
It starts with offense. Les runs an offense that is not just outdated, but its run by almost no other out there. Any upcoming OC wants to become well-versed in CURRENT offensive trends, and learn that, or in many cases, its what they already know.
Les' offense is not being used by anyone, the terminology is not being used by anyone, and its likely not going to be used by anyone before too long.
Its like being an Engineering major, and you already have a career in oil & gas ready, and they ask you to take a class in civil engineering where everything is done by hand with a slide rule.
